Visits in Milan:
• Sforzesco Castle: One of the largest fortified cities in Europe built in the 14th century Medieval era by the ruler of Milan, Francesco Sforza.
• Milan Cathedral: A unique Gothic church that has become an icon of the city of Milan, built since 1386.
• Free time for shopping at Galleria Vittorio Emanuele II, the oldest shopping mall in Italy since 1877 which houses various famous designer boutiques such as Prada, Gucci and LV.

Tours in Venice:
• San Marco Square: The main square that houses various attractions around it such as the San Marco Basilica church and is also the site of any major events on the island.
• Doge’s Palace: The former residence of the Venetian rulers, built in 1340 with Gothic carvings and now a museum.
• Bridge Of Sighs: A bridge famous for Casanova’s love story that connects the Doge’s Palace with the prison.
• St Mark’s Campanile: The 99m-tall bell tower was built in 1912 after the original tower built in 1514 collapsed in 1902.
• Grand Canal: The main and largest canal in the archipelago that separates San Marco and San Polo and is connected by the Rialto Bridge, the iconic and oldest bridge in the city of Venice which was completed in 1591.

Tours in Ljubljana:
• Preseran Square: The main square located in the center of the city and is a focal point for locals to relax, as well as being home to iconic buildings in the city.
• Triple Bridge: 3 twin bridges built in 1842 that cross the Ljubljanica River and connect the old town and the new town.
• Dragon Bridge: A unique bridge in the middle of the city with dragon-like statues guarding those crossing this bridge.
• Free time for souvenir and fruit shopping at Ljubljana Central Market.
• Take photos at the Ljubljana Town Hall, built in 1717, and the Robba Fountain located in front of it.
